Energy verified Verified

Grid-Scale Battery for Frequency Control

South Australia had high renewable penetration but an unstable grid, suffering a statewide blackout in 2016. Gas generators exercised market power, charging exorbitant rates for 'frequency control' services needed to keep the grid at 50Hz.

domain Tesla (Megapack) public Global
Key Outcome Saved consumers $150M+ in first two years Primary Impact View Case

Energy verified Verified

Vehicle-to-Grid (V2G) School Buses

Electric school buses cost 3x more than diesel ($350k vs $120k). School districts couldn't afford the upfront capital despite the long-term fuel savings. Meanwhile, utilities faced summer peak demand issues.

domain Highland Electric Fleets public Global
Key Outcome Discharged 27.7 MWh back to grid (Beverly Pilot) Primary Impact View Case
Energy verified Verified

Robotic Wind Blade Maintenance

Wind turbine blades degrade due to erosion, lightning, and ice, reducing efficiency. Maintenance required technicians to rappel down blades (rope access), which is weather-dependent, slow, and highly dangerous. Downtime for repairs meant lost energy revenue.

domain Aerones public Global
Key Outcome Maintenance speed increased by 400-600% Primary Impact View Case
